Shovel Knight Is Coming To Nintendo Switch

One of the best 2D platformers of recent times, Shovel Knight, is heading to the Nintendo Switch. Yacht Club games have written on their official blog that Shovel Knight: Treasure Trove and Shovel Knight: Specter of Torment will be released for Nintendo’s next generation console.
